Background
WDR Sportschau is the sports desk and flagship weekly magazine of Westdeutscher Rundfunk (WDR), the Cologne-based public broadcaster and largest member of Germany's ARD network. Sportschau itself has run since 1961, with its Saturday edition built around a Bundesliga round-up and its Sunday edition covering other sports.
WDR, founded in 1956, is funded chiefly by licence-fee revenue with limited on-air advertising, giving Sportschau a public-service REMIT distinct from commercially driven sports coverage elsewhere in Europe.
The desk is an IBC 2026 Innovation Award nominee for AutoCut, an AI audio-highlights tool developed with deliver.media and the EBU, positioning a public broadcaster's in-house sports operation alongside commercial vendors in the industry's AI production showcase.
